site stats

Grok's pattern dictionary

WebJul 18, 2024 · use gsub in the filter: mutate: { gsub => [ "message", "TAB", " " ] } It will remove the TAB to " " (space) Regards, Fadjar Tandabawana WebLet’s start with an example unstructured log message, which we will then structure with a Grok pattern: 128.39.24.23 - - [25/Dec/2024:12:16:50 +0000] "GET …

TAB in grok filter and delete mismatched records

WebMay 14, 2024 · In the logstash file, he read the logstash input Line by Line, put the first value in quote in the field key and the second one in the field value. You can do that with a … WebJun 10, 2015 · I'm trying to use a grok filter in logstash version 1.5.0 to parse several fields of data from a log file. I'm able to parse a simple WORD field with no issues, but when I try to define a custom pattern and add that in as well, the grok parse fails. I've tried using a couple of grok debuggers which have been recommended elsewhere to find an issue: feign httpclient timeout https://boonegap.com

Grokking grok Elasticsearch Guide [7.14] Elastic

WebSep 3, 2024 · Within Kibana, go to Dev Tools > Grok Debugger, and then paste in the data and the grok pattern as shown below: The structured data response is empty, which confirms that the grok pattern did not match the sample data. Let’s make sure that the Grok Debugger is working by defining a pattern that we know will match anything, and … WebFeb 21, 2024 · The grok data format parses line-delimited data using a regular expression-like language. For an introduction to grok patterns, see Grok Basics in the Logstash documentation. The grok parser uses a slightly modified version of logstash “grok” patterns, using the format: The capture_syntax defines the grok pattern that is used to … WebJul 11, 2016 · While the Oxford English Dictionary summarizes the meaning of grok as "to understand intuitively". Grok works by combining text patterns into something that matches your logs. This tool is perfect for syslog logs, apache and other webserver logs, mysql logs, and in general, any log format that is generally written for humans and not computer ... define walt whitman

Using Custom Regex Patterns in Logstash by Songtham Tung

Category:Writing custom classifiers - AWS Glue

Tags:Grok's pattern dictionary

Grok's pattern dictionary

GitHub - Marusyk/grok.net: .NET implementation of the grok 📝

WebThe syntax for a grok pattern is % {SYNTAX:SEMANTIC} The SYNTAX is the name of the pattern that will match your text. SEMANTIC is the key. For example, 3.44 will be … WebSep 28, 2016 · There are over 200 grok patterns available which abstract concepts such as IPv6 addresses, UNIX paths and names of months. In order to match a line with the format: 2016-09-19T18:19:00 [8.8.8.8:prd] DEBUG this is an example log message with the grok library, it's only necessary to compose a handful of patterns to come up with:

Grok's pattern dictionary

Did you know?

WebJan 22, 2024 · I'm not sure if this approach would work and it seems overcomplicated when you compare with the approach in the documentation to use custom patterns.. You could try putting your custom regex expressions in a file and use the patterns_dir option in your grok filter.. For example, you could create a file named CUSTOM-REGEX with the following … WebJun 29, 2016 · Querying Kibana using grok pattern. We have configured ELK stack over our daily logs and using Kibana UI to perform basic search/query operation on the the set of logs. Some of our logs have a certain field in the message while others don't. Therefore we have not configured it as a separate field while configuring Logstash.

WebJul 11, 2016 · While the Oxford English Dictionary summarizes the meaning of grok as "to understand intuitively". Grok works by combining text patterns into something that … WebJun 26, 2024 · GrokTests unit tests fail with "Unable to find pattern [] in Grok's pattern dictionary" #43673. Closed alpar-t opened this issue Jun 27, 2024 · 16 comments · …

WebLogstash Plugin. This plugin provides pattern definitions used by the grok filter.. It is fully free and fully open source. The license is Apache 2.0, meaning you are pretty much free to use it however you want in whatever way. WebGrok is a tool that is used to parse textual data given a matching pattern. A grok pattern is a named set of regular expressions (regex) that are used to match data one line at a time. AWS Glue uses grok patterns to infer the schema of your data. When a grok pattern matches your data, AWS Glue uses the pattern to determine the structure of your ...

WebJan 19, 2024 · Here, we use a RegEx pattern, but of course, we can also use Grok patterns when we need to. With negate set to true, a message that matches the pattern is not considered a match for the multiline filter. By default, this is set to false and when it is false, a message that matches the pattern is considered a match for multiline.

WebApr 9, 2024 · A grok pattern is a named set of regular expressions (regex) that are used to match data one line at a time. AWS Glue uses grok patterns to infer the schema of your data. feign httpsWebPattern Translation. This tries to generate a grok regular expression from a log4j PatternLayout format that parses the logfile output generated by that format. You will … define wantedlyWebThe syntax for a grok pattern is % {SYNTAX:SEMANTIC} The SYNTAX is the name of the pattern that will match your text. SEMANTIC is the key. For example, 3.44 will be matched by the NUMBER pattern and 55.3.244.1 will be matched by the IP pattern. 3.44 could be the duration of an event, so you could call it simply duration. define wan computerWebgrok meaning: 1. to understand something: 2. to understand something: . Learn more. define wampanoag indiansWebGrok Pattern Definition. Use to define a complex or custom grok pattern. You can use this property to define a pattern for a single grok pattern or to define multiple patterns for … define wampanoagWebSep 22, 2024 · Enter an Attribute / Value pair to act as a pre-filter. This will narrow down the number of logs that need to be processed by this rule, removing unnecessary processing. In this case, select the attribute “entity.name” and the value “Inventory Service.”. Add the Grok parse rule. In this case: feign hurtWebHere custom patterns can be loaded into the dictionary by passing in a File object representing the directory where the patterns are stored. GrokDictionary.addDictionary(InputStream) Here custom patterns can be loaded into the dictionary by passing in an inpustream containing the named expressions. … define wan connection